Gorilla is a data analytics company based in Antwerp, Belgium, focused on transforming the energy and utility industry. Overview
Gorilla is hiring a Chief of Staff to tackle strategic challenges in the energy sector. You'll drive company-wide priorities and ensure effective execution. This role requires strong leadership and strategic thinking skills.
Job Description
Who you are
As the Chief of Staff at Gorilla, you are the strategic partner to the CEO, adept at turning high-level strategies into actionable plans. You possess a keen understanding of people, quickly building trust and navigating complex interpersonal dynamics with empathy. Your calm demeanor under pressure sharpens your decision-making abilities, allowing you to influence outcomes effectively, even without formal authority. You value speed but maintain good judgment, knowing when to prioritize quality over haste. Integrity is paramount for you; you handle sensitive information with discretion and operate with a systems-thinking mindset, connecting various aspects of the business including product, revenue, operations, and finance. Your curiosity about the business landscape drives you to understand customers, markets, and metrics deeply.
What you'll do
In this role, you will be responsible for driving the company's strategic initiatives and ensuring that decisions are not only made but also executed effectively. You will connect teams around shared priorities, enhancing the organization's operating rhythm and decision-making processes. Your role will involve unlocking executive bandwidth, allowing the leadership team to focus on high-impact priorities. You will work closely with various departments to ensure alignment and foster collaboration, ultimately contributing to the company's mission of leading the energy transition. Your influence will be critical in shaping the company's strategic direction and operational effectiveness.
